The name of the narrative is "Resistance to civil government (Civil Disobedience)" and was written by Henry David Thoreau.

I believe the answer is: "Resistance to civil government (Civil Disobedience)"


The main idea of the civil disobedience is to advocate the people to not ever let the government overrule their conscience .

He pointed Mexican–American War as one of the example because he perceived the war as an act of injustice for the people of Mexico.
